Exhibit 99.1 ASX ANNOUNCEMENT - 2026 HALF YEAR RESULTS 11 August 2026 Coronado Global Resources today reported its Half Year 2026 results, with a significant operational and financial recovery achieved in the June quarter. The SEC 8-K includes an ASX announcement for Coronado Global Resources’ Half Year 2026 results, highlighting safety metrics, operational recovery, Buchanan expansion benefits, and a Curragh reset program.
Ticker impact
Coronado reports Half Year 2026 results, citing a June-quarter operational recovery, improved Q2 earnings, and a Curragh margin and cash reset program.
Near-term trading bias could be positive if investors view the operational recovery and reset execution as credible, but follow-through into FY2027 is the key swing factor.
The article provides qualitative operational milestones (nearly 40% higher saleable production vs March, Q2 earnings improved by about US$100m, record CHPP hours) and a concrete portfolio action (Logan divestment), but it is an excerpt and lacks full financial tables and guidance detail.

Key entities
- companyCoronado Global Resources Inc.
Subject of the 8-K, reporting Half Year 2026 results and operational recovery initiatives at Buchanan and Curragh.
- assetBuchanan
Highest-margin operation, with expansion capacity of about 4.5 Mtpa and record first-half ROM production.
- assetCurragh
Undergoing a mine plan and operational reset to improve stability, margins, and cash generation, including CHPP throughput and plant availability focus.
- assetLogan Complex
Divested at end of July to reduce exposure to structurally challenged High-Vol coal markets.
- advisorsAlixPartners and Odin Partnership
Named as supporting implementation of the Curragh reset program.
